This chapter includes the following sections: This chapter describes how to identify and resolve problems that can occur with Layer 2 switching in the Cisco Nexus 5000 Series switch. Layer 2 is the Data Link Layer of the Open Systems Interconnection model (OSI model) of computer networking. Configuring interface to access port does not allow VLAN to go through.Nexus 5000 does not have the same VLANs as switch running VTP server.Multicast traffic is being flooded in a VPC setup.Multicast data traffic not received when host is registered for group.Multicast data traffic not received by host. Source MAC addresses of IGMP joins are learned.Port stuck in STP blocking state with BLK*(Loop_Inc).
